Abstract

The utility model relates to the technical field of film rolling machines, in particular to a support for a film rolling machine, which comprises a base, an installation supporting mechanism and a lifting mechanism are arranged on the upper end face of the base, and the installation supporting mechanism comprises two vertical plates which are connected to the upper end face of the base in a sliding mode and distributed front and back. The opposite side walls of the two vertical plates are each rotationally connected with a rotating disc, the opposite side walls of the two rotating discs are each fixedly connected with a supporting column of a conical structure, and the lifting mechanism comprises a lifting block which is arranged on the upper end face of the base and located between the two vertical plates; the two vertical plates drive the two supporting columns to enter the openings in the two ends of the film rolling barrel correspondingly, then the film rolling barrel fully wound with materials is installed and supported, due to the fact that the supporting columns are of a conical structure and can move relatively, the film rolling barrels of different specifications can be installed and supported, and meanwhile, the supporting columns can move relatively. And through the lifting block, the film rolling barrel fully wound with materials can be conveniently installed and supported, potential safety hazards are avoided, and use is convenient.

Description

Technical Field

[0001] This utility model relates to the field of film rolling machine technology, and specifically discloses a support for a film rolling machine. Background Technology

[0002] Film winding machines are specialized equipment used in the packaging industry to process film materials. They are mainly used to unfold, convey, position, or rewind flexible materials such as plastic films and composite films. They are widely used in automated packaging production lines for food, pharmaceuticals, and daily chemicals. The film winding machine bracket is the core component of the film winding machine used to support and fix the film roll (film roll). Its function is similar to a "skeleton" and directly affects the stability, efficiency, and equipment compatibility of film conveying.

[0003] Existing supports for film winding machines are mostly fixed in structure and can only accommodate film rolls of a single size. They cannot support film rolls of different specifications. In addition, the existing supports fix the film rolls at a high position. Film rolls fully wrapped with material are heavy, making the installation and support process difficult and posing certain safety hazards, thus making them inconvenient to use. Utility Model Content

[0021] The markings in the diagram are: 1. Base; 2. Vertical plate; 3. Turntable; 4. Support column; 5. Lifting block; 6. Slide groove; 7. Screw; 8. Slider; 9. Drive motor; 10. Stepper motor; 11. Electric telescopic rod; 12. Friction strip; 13. Limiting groove. Detailed Implementation

[0023] Please see Figure 1-4 A support for a film rolling machine includes a base 1, and the upper end face of the base 1 is provided with a mounting support mechanism and a lifting mechanism.

[0024] The mounting support mechanism includes two vertical plates 2 that are slidably connected to the upper surface of the base 1 and distributed in the front and back. A turntable 3 is rotatably connected to one of the opposite side walls of the two vertical plates 2, and a support column 4 with a conical structure is fixedly connected to one of the opposite side walls of the two turntables 3.

[0025] The lifting mechanism includes a lifting block 5 disposed on the upper surface of the base 1 and located between two vertical plates 2;

[0026] The upper surface of the base 1 has two sliding grooves 6 distributed front and back. The interior of each sliding groove 6 is rotatably connected to a screw 7. The lower surfaces of the two vertical plates 2 are fixedly connected to sliders 8 that are threadedly connected to the two screws 7 respectively.

[0027] In this embodiment: During use, the film roll fully wrapped with material is placed into the limiting groove 13 on the lifting block 5. The limiting groove 13 can limit the film roll fully wrapped with material, preventing it from rolling freely. Then, the lifting block 5 is pushed up by the electric telescopic rod 11 until the lifting block 5 moves the film roll fully wrapped with material between the two support columns 4. Then, the two screws 7 rotate, and the two screws 7 cooperate with the two sliders 8 to drive the two vertical plates 2 to move in opposite directions. The two vertical plates 2 drive the two support columns 4 to enter the openings at both ends of the film roll, thereby installing and supporting the film roll fully wrapped with material. Since the support columns 4 have a conical structure and can move relative to each other, film rolls of different specifications can be installed and supported. At the same time, the lifting block 5 facilitates the installation and support of the film roll fully wrapped with material, avoids safety hazards, and is convenient to use.

[0028] As a technical optimization of this utility model, a drive motor 9 is installed on the rear end face of the rear vertical plate 2, and the output end of the drive motor 9 is fixedly connected to the turntable 3 located at the rear.

[0029] In this embodiment: the drive motor 9 can drive the turntable 3 located at the rear to rotate, and then the turntable 3 located at the rear, together with the two support columns 4 and the turntable 3 located at the front, drives the film roll full of material to rotate, thereby unwinding the material on the film roll.

[0030] As a technical optimization of this utility model, stepper motors 10 are installed on both the front and rear ends of the base 1, and the output ends of the two stepper motors 10 are respectively fixedly connected to two screws 7.

[0031] In this embodiment, two stepper motors 10 can drive two screws 7 to rotate respectively.

[0032] As a technical optimization of this utility model, an electric telescopic rod 11 is installed on the lower end face of the base 1, and the output end of the electric telescopic rod 11 is fixedly connected to the lifting block 5.

[0033] In this embodiment, the lifting block 5 can be moved by the electric telescopic rod 11.

[0034] As a technical optimization of this utility model, the outer walls of the two support columns 4 are provided with multiple arrayed friction strips 12.

[0035] In this embodiment, the friction strip 12 can increase the friction between the support column 4 and the film roll, so that the support column 4 can stably drive the film roll to rotate and prevent the film roll from slipping on the outer wall of the support column 4.

[0036] As a technical optimization of this utility model, a limiting groove 13 is provided on the upper end surface of the lifting block 5.

[0037] In this embodiment, the limiting groove 13 can limit the roll of film wrapped with material, preventing the roll of film wrapped with material from rolling randomly.

[0038] The working principle and usage process of this utility model are as follows: When in use, the roll of film wrapped with material is placed into the limiting groove 13 on the lifting block 5. Then, the lifting block 5 is pushed up by the electric telescopic rod 11 until the lifting block 5 moves the roll of film wrapped with material between the two support columns 4. Then, the two stepper motors 10 drive the two screws 7 to rotate. The two screws 7 cooperate with the two sliders 8 to drive the two vertical plates 2 to move in opposite directions. The two vertical plates 2 drive the two support columns 4 to enter the openings at both ends of the roll of film, thereby installing and supporting the roll of film wrapped with material.

[0039] Then, the drive motor 9 drives the turntable 3 located at the rear to rotate. The turntable 3 located at the rear, together with the two support columns 4 and the turntable 3 located at the front, drives the film roll full of material to rotate, thereby unwinding the material on the film roll.
